真真 HeiderGermany · September 2026

Fun and flexible 2 weeks of 1-on-1 classes and live experience

My experience with LTL has been great: fun, flexible and unforgettable. As a Chinese heritage speaker I went looking for a school that would offer an individualised learning experience with “live-action“ support in Taipei, and from the start LTL‘s team were attuned to my needs and wishes. My student advisor Josephine answered each and every one of my questions in detail, and she followed up with a structured plan within a few days. I decided on 1-on-1 classes for 2 weeks with 20 classes per week, 50% of them being safari classes, and the connection kit. Safari classes are outings into Taipei i.e. store or museum visits that are accompanied by your language teacher to give you real-life Mandarin speaking experience. The connection kit meant that I was set up with a Mandarin-speaker in Taipei to go out with. The online onboarding couldn‘t have run more smoothly thanks to highly detailed enquiries, to an online placement test and to a video call with Alin to get a feel for my actual speaking level and to answer any eventual questions I might have had before coming to Taipei. Additionally, LTL provided detailed guides on how to get through the airport and into the city itself, and they added me to the Line student group in advance. That way if I had had any questions I could have asked LTL Taipei‘s team any time. On my first day at LTL my teacher Issa took great care to check in with what I wanted to focus on including my interests for the safari classes. She then drew up a plan for both our textbook Chinese lessons and potential outings. I appreciate her gentle and flexible approach that encouraged me while being very clear on the areas that I needed to improve, in my case mostly the tones. She offered consistent corrective feedback on my intonation and introduced me to a method to acquire a more natural pronunciation. In the first week we focused more on the textbook lessons in MTU’s ”A Course in Contemporary Chinese“ to give me a starting point. At the same time Issa left plenty of room to go on tangents related to my stay in Taipei. I felt very well guided, though the pace was high with 20+ new vocabulary per day and short reviews. In the second week we focused more on Safari classes with pre-scheduled outings to a bubble tea shop, to the stationer‘s, to a day market, to a post office and to a tea house among others. Issa went above and beyond to prepare me for these outdoor assignments with individualised vocabulary lists and example dialogues. She also provided rich insights into Taiwan‘s everyday life and plenty of suggestions for places to visit and foods to try. While I felt quite a nervous to speak to shopkeepers with my basic Chinese skills Issa‘s support helped me to build up my confidence to go out to apply my Chinese even after the language classes were over. In addition to all these intensive classes the team at LTL Taipei made my stay unforgettable by organising frequent and diverse social events i.e. almost daily lunch outings, creative Taiwanese craft workshops, a museum visit, a KTV night, a Mahjong afternoon, etc. A shout-out to Sunny! Her infectious enthusiasm and inventiveness made my stay at LTL unforgettable. Plus other teachers and staff would join some of these events and even expand them at times. So even though I had 1-on-1 classes I still got to connect to other students every day. My only hiccup was related to the connection kit when my original partner became unavailable, but Riona and Sunny resolved it within 2 days‘s time. The administration at LTL Taipei is flawless! I can‘t recommend LTL Taipei enough! They provide such a comprehensive experience way beyond just language classes! So if you consider attending, make sure to leave enough room in your schedule to enjoy the full experience. Taipei‘s team guarantees that you will Live The Language!

Jerry KGermany · August 2026

A great way to learn Chinese in Taipei

I spent six weeks at LTL Taipei taking a 1-on-1 Chinese course. From the beginning, everything was easy and well organized. Communication before my arrival was smooth, the classes were great, and there were plenty of activities outside of class. Even though I had 1-on-1 lessons, I still got to know other students and teachers quite easily. The atmosphere at the school is very friendly and relaxed. There are many international students speaking English, and many people in Taipei speak good English as well. But if you make an effort to meet locals and use Chinese in everyday life, there are still plenty of opportunities to practice. Taipei itself is also a great city to study in—very convenient, easy to get around, and there’s always something to do. Just be prepared for the VERY hot and rainy weather in June/July! I had Jessica 老師 as my teacher, and she quickly understood my level and asked what I wanted to achieve. Although I had learned Simplified Chinese before, that wasn’t a problem at all. LTL Taipei teaches both Simplified and Traditional Chinese, and I got used to Traditional much faster than I expected. Since my main goal was to refresh my Chinese and improve my speaking, Jessica adapted the lessons to me instead of just following the textbook. From day one, we spoke almost entirely in Chinese, which helped a lot with my listening and speaking. I had classes every morning from 9 a.m. to 1 p.m., but I never felt overwhelmed and the four hours always went by surprisingly quickly. Jessica was also very kind and supportive—she even brought me breakfast a few times! After six weeks, I could really feel that my Chinese had improved. There were different activities every week, such as Mahjong, karaoke, museums, cultural activities, and group lunches near the school. Sunny and Riona put so much effort into organizing everything. They were always friendly and approachable, and they definitely made the course more enjoyable! Alin organized my classes and found a teacher who was a really good match for me. Greta was also very helpful before and during my stay. I had some issues with my original homestay arrangement, and she took my concerns seriously and really tried to help find a solution, which I appreciated a lot. The only thing I think could be improved is the homestay program. From my own experience and from talking to other students, the quality of host families seems to vary quite a bit. It would be helpful to have more consistent standards regarding things like cleanliness, distance from the school, and how involved the host family is. I also think it would be better to get information about the homestay earlier. Considering the price, renting a private room or apartment nearby can sometimes be a better option. Of course, I’m sure there are also many great host families—it may just depend a little on luck. Overall, I’d definitely recommend LTL Taipei to anyone thinking about studying Chinese in Taiwan. I learned a lot in six weeks, met some really nice people, and had a great time. If I come back to Taipei, I’d definitely consider taking another course at LTL.

JT GUnited States · June 2026

LTL Taipei is where it's at!

I've had a wonderful three weeks here at LTL Taipei. They are very organized, the teachers are all skilled and enthusiastic, and the non-teaching staff (particularly Riona and Sunny) do such a great job creating a community out of a group of students from a diverse array of backgrounds and Chinese ability levels (organized lunches and cultural excursions/activities every week!!). I really might come back next year! I started off in a group class for one week and switched to 1-on-1 for the latter two, and I'm grateful LTL was flexible with me on this. This is a company, not a university, so there aren't any exams or a rigid pace. This is both good and bad; it means they're way more flexible with adult learners' schedules and the atmosphere is welcoming and non-stressful, but it also means students aren't as disciplined and the teachers are accustomed to giving very little homework, which means slow language progress. For motivated students I strongly recommend the 1-on-1 classes so that you can go at the fastest pace that feels comfortable to you; I would only recommend the group classes for complete beginners or those okay with a very slow pace.

Nico BährGermany · November 2025

Awesome intense Mandarin class in Taipei

It was a great decision to spend my educational leave (Bildungsurlaub) at the LTL language school in Taipei. Here are the reasons: + very professional teachers (mine were Tammy, Francine, Yunni and Wolfgang) who + explained grammar and new vocabulary (and its differences to similar words) very understandably; + explained everything in Chinese (at my B1-Level course) which let me immerse myself into the language very well; + are proficient in English so that they can offer English translations, if necessary; - one teacher‘s pronounciation was a little bit unclear and another‘s Chinese characters’ handwriting sometimes a bit difficult to read; + the teachers adjusted the class content to my personal needs (e.g. not only sticking to the book but also taught me other vocabulary when I said that I would like to learn more about a certain other topic); + created an open learning environment that never made me feel bad when I couldn’t pronounce a word correctly or so; + only gave few homework; - once a teacher mixed up the schedule and came half an hour too late, but > + she made up for it by offering another additional class time; + in general, the teachers rather taught a few minutes longer than shorter, so in total I might have had more than one free extra hour of classes. Besides, there are additional reasons, why I recommend LTL in Taipei: + opportunity to book a course for only one week and different amounts of class hours, group and/or single classes makes LTL very flexible; / 6 hours per day is veeery intensive, next time I might switch to four hours per day; + nevertheless, the mix of group classes and private classes was awesome; + very small groups (in my group class was only one other student); - ca. 750€ per week is quite a lot of money (but worth it); + very helpful staff (e.g. Alin, always there for questions); + organised community events (such as a very fun Lasertag evening with teacher Alice and daily lunches with lovely Riona); + workshops about Chinese/Taiwanese culture (e.g. Mahjong with teacher Tammy). Recommended!

Can I learn Chinese in China with LTL

Yes, we also have multiple schools in Mainland China. Cities include Beijing, Shanghai, Chengdu, and more.

Can I meet other people even if I study individually?

Absolutely, we pride ourselves on being a home away from home for you.

We run after school activities which can include visits to historical and touristy places, parks or shopping areas. We can also organise cooking classes, calligraphy classes, traditional clothes fittings, movie nights, etc. These are great places to get to know other LTL students.

When will my Chinese classes be?

Lessons are held during the day from Monday to Friday, with mornings being standard for most students.

In periods of high enrolment, some classes may run later in the day. While time slots are predetermined, we can move you to another class if availability permits.

How long can I learn Chinese at LTL Taipei?

Our courses last anything from 1 to 52 weeks. You choose how long you wish to learn Chinese in Taipei with LTL.

Some people even book another course after their first one is complete so it’s truly flexible.

If you are unsure about the optimum length for your program, we would be happy to hear about your project and assist you in this decision.

Can I study Chinese intensively?

Yes all our courses are intensive, but we also offer a 6-hour per day course. 

This is our most intensive option and students who partake in this program often progress faster than many others.
